Using skills to accelerate OSS maintenance
Blog post from OpenAI
OpenAI has effectively enhanced the maintenance of its Agents SDK repositories by leveraging Codex for automating recurring engineering tasks such as verification, release preparation, and integration testing. This approach utilizes repo-local skills, AGENTS.md for repository-level instructions, and GitHub Actions to increase development throughput, as evidenced by the significant rise in merged pull requests. The Python and TypeScript SDKs, used at a large scale with millions of downloads, benefit from structured workflows that standardize operational triggers and ensure consistency in engineering tasks. Each skill in the setup operates with a clear contract, triggering specific actions based on repository changes, thus enabling repeatable and reliable processes. The integration of skills with Codex allows for a clear separation between deterministic tasks handled by scripts and context-dependent tasks managed by the model, enhancing the efficiency of tasks like automated integration testing and release readiness reviews. This structured approach not only streamlines workflow management but also significantly contributes to faster release cycles and improved code quality by providing consistent processes for PR reviews and other critical engineering tasks.
